Ten Injured in Collision Between Van and Truck on East-West Highway
Ten people were injured when an EV van and a truck collided on the East-West Highway in Nawalparasi (West). The accident occurred in the Nawalparasi district, which is situated along the crucial East-West Highway in Nepal. Emergency services responded to the scene to provide aid to the injured. Further details regarding the severity of the injuries and the cause of the accident have not yet been released.
